Duty Manager

Starting Rate £12.60 per hour.

Pay reviews are based on length of service and additional responsibilities.

As part of the small multifunctional team the role of Duty Manager is central to the effective running of the Centre. You will be responsible for the provision of a safe, fun and welcoming climbing environment. When on duty you will directly manage the day-to-day operations including the reception, café and shop with additional responsibilities including cleaning and administrative tasks.

  • Experienced applicants are preferred but full training will be given
  • All applicants must be able to arrive at the centre for 5.45am to complete opening shifts.
  • The roles will cover the full range of the centre’s extensive opening hours.
  • Your chosen site will be your primary site but you will occasionally have the opportunity to work at other LCC locations

RMI – Regional Painter/Decorator

Hours: 30hrs – 40hrs per week

Salary: £13 – £16 per hour depending on experience

Reporting to: Regional RMI Manager (Repairs, Maintenance & Improvements)

The Role:

As our dedicated décor specialist you will be responsible for keeping our climbing centres looking fresh with a rotationally based site secondment across our London portfolio. You will assist the Regional RMI Manager and the rest of the team in keeping our centres the best they can be. We require someone who knows the industry products well, has attention to detail, a good work ethic, is punctual, flexible, adaptable, and takes pride in their work. You will also play a part in our centre improvement projects and play a key part in LCC’s expansion program working alongside our Regional RMI Manager, RMI team, and LCC’s approved contractors.

You will be required to undertake knot and prime, patch plastering, filling, sanding, drylining, the use of water, oil, and solvent-based paints, varnishing, cutting in, prep work, and general painting and decorating duties. You will have working at heights experience and will be required at times to work out of hours and weekends if the job or project requires between the hours of 6am and 6pm. All equipment and tools will be provided onsite. However, you must have the ability to travel to site by your own means. Additional training will be provided for the right candidate.

Required:

  • Understanding of COSH & HASAWA 1974
  • At least 1 year of experience in the Industry
  • Extensive Knowledge of Industry products

Desired:

  • City and Guilds 6707 L1/L2
  • PASMA certified
  • IPAF Certified
  • Commercial awareness
